Israeli forces have demolished two apartments in al-Walaja village, west of Bethlehem. Elsewhere, settlers set fire to a tractor in Burqa after attacking the village northwest of Nablus. They also attempted to set a vehicle on fire and to spray graffiti on a house. The Palestinian news agency Wafa reported that settlers in Khirbet al-Deir, southwest of Bethlehem, paved a dirt road to facilitate their access to the area’s freshwater spring. Israeli settlements in the occupied West Bank and occupied East Jerusalem are illegal under international law. The ICJ reaffirmed that position last year, saying Israel’s presence in the occupied Palestinian territory is unlawful and must end.
